One quick clarifier....Chinese artichokes are not Jerusalem artichokes...i.e., not sunchokes.  Chinese artichokes are a low growing (about 12-18" high) ground cover that makes loads of little tubers, while sunchokes are tall clumpers that make larger tubers.  To make the common name fun even stickier....there are Chinese Jerusalem artichokes (oh my!)  I'm offering the Chinese artichoke here....the so called crosnes (pronounced crones).  If anyone is heart set on sunchokes let me know and I may be able to do that instead, but I'll need to do mainly crosnes as that's the one I have many, many more of!  Thank you all for being such great supporters of this kickstarter.  Just a little over $3k to go to reach the important next stretch goal...and only a half hour left!!
